BACKGROUND
Benoît Déhu is a rising star among grower-producers in Champagne, based in Fossoy in the Vallée de la Marne. After working for Bollinger, he returned to his family estate and began a meticulous project focusing on a single 1.7-hectare parcel called 'La Rue des Noyers'. He farms this plot biodynamically, using horses for plowing. The 'La Rue des Noyers' Champagne is a Blanc de Noirs made entirely from Pinot Meunier. Fermented and aged in oak barrels made from trees grown near the vineyard, and bottled as Brut Nature (zero dosage), it is a wine of incredible tension, purity, and complex earthy, orchard-fruit flavors.
